>I get "ANS4071E Invalid domain name entered: '/usr/local/bin'" for
>example.  All nodes are defined in my domain; I don't know where else to
>look (since I've looked at just about everything 3 times already).

Maybe the argument to your "dsmc incr" command was NOT a filespace (ie the
mount point of a filesystem) ?  If not, that could be the problem.

I just tried "dsmc incr /some_directory" and I get that infamous ANS4071E.
